Default Joe DiMaggio 56 Game Hitting Streak Game Used Ball

Very happy & lucky to find this out there. A rare game used baseball from game 21 of DiMaggio's 56 Game Hitting Streak.

Seller "Recently found at an estate in NW Michigan from a Glen Lake cottage built in the 1930's is a Game Baseball from a New York Yankees at Detroit Tigers game played on June 5th 1941." and no reason to doubt the story, as seller is from Michigan and no history of baseball items, but a good long time seller.

Love when the ball is found in the home state of the home team or player. I think that adds to it. Also the ink is vintage and the Reach (faded but visible) stamping matches up to a 1941 A.L. Ball. My best find until this one was a game used 1917 World Series ball for $80. I think I like this 56 gamer better. Oh also found a Foul Ball of the bat of Gehrig, which I sold to a fellow member here and have tried unsuccessfully getting it back from him, oh well its in good hands.

Guessing from what the original attendee of this game in '41 wrote on the ball was this could be a foul ball off Frankie "The Crow" Crosetti's bat pitched by Hall of Famer Harold "Hal" Newhouser, who the person wrote Harold as he was only 20 years old and maybe didn't go by Hal just yet. No real other reason to note Crosetti on the ball who went 0-4.

DiMaggio's only hit in this game (to keep the streak alive) was a triple in the 6th inning, Crosetti batted 2 batters later and flied out. Was this the ball DiMaggio tripled with then Crosetti knocked it out of play? I wish, but who knows.

Also, when I was looking at the box score I noticed Bill Dickey wasn't in the lineup this game which I found odd since he was their starting catcher. But researching it more, Dickey and Joe McCarthy were not at this game in Detroit because they were attending Lou Gehrig's funeral. Dickey being Gehrig's roommate when they played together.

I had the case made for the ball. I could only find 2 other balls from his Streak that have come to auction. So I feel this is a pretty rare significant find.
